Julie Zauzmer Weil is a Tax Reporter at The Washington Post. She covers a range of topics including taxes, housing market dynamics, and financial planning, drawing from her previous experience reporting on religion and local government. Julie's work has been featured in numerous publications, including the Frederick News-Post, Yahoo News, and The Boston Globe.
